Searched refs:venus_writel (Results 1 – 1 of 1) sorted by relevance
/Linux-v4.19/drivers/media/platform/qcom/venus/ |
D | hfi_venus.c | 362 static void venus_writel(struct venus_hfi_device *hdev, u32 reg, u32 value) in venus_writel() function 380 venus_writel(hdev, tbl[i].reg, tbl[i].value); in venus_set_registers() 385 venus_writel(hdev, CPU_IC_SOFTINT, BIT(CPU_IC_SOFTINT_H2A_SHIFT)); in venus_soft_int() 460 venus_writel(hdev, VIDC_CTRL_INIT, BIT(VIDC_CTRL_INIT_CTRL_SHIFT)); in venus_boot_core() 461 venus_writel(hdev, WRAPPER_INTR_MASK, WRAPPER_INTR_MASK_A2HVCODEC_MASK); in venus_boot_core() 462 venus_writel(hdev, CPU_CS_SCIACMDARG3, 1); in venus_boot_core() 510 venus_writel(hdev, UC_REGION_ADDR, hdev->ifaceq_table.da); in venus_run() 511 venus_writel(hdev, UC_REGION_SIZE, SHARED_QSIZE); in venus_run() 512 venus_writel(hdev, CPU_CS_SCIACMDARG2, hdev->ifaceq_table.da); in venus_run() 513 venus_writel(hdev, CPU_CS_SCIACMDARG1, 0x01); in venus_run() [all …]
|